Small Kansas towns have faced many challenges over the years, and 2012 has been no exception. The town of Burlingame is one of those fighting for its economic survival. Patty Gilbert is the town's city clerk.
Gilbert says one positive development is that Burlingame's post office is NOT being targeted for closure, and that means there's still a lot of hope that the town can survive. Gilbert says area boosters are hoping for a big turnout at the town's annual "Country Christmas" event, which will feature lots of activities, including a craft show, hayrack rides, stagecoach rides...
The Country Christmas event is scheduled for this Saturday (December 1) in Burlingame.
